Fast forward merge vs merge commit
WebMay 31, 2024 · Lets recap the three main options of integrating git branches: git merge –no-ff : The “no-fast-forward” merge option preserves the branch history and creates a merge commit.; git merge : The “fast-forward” (“–ff”) merge option is the default merge option (when possible).In the git log, the branch history for this merge will not be available … WebApr 5, 2024 · The general syntax for this git command is: git merge --no-ff . The Git merge --no-ff command merges the specified branch into the command in the current branch and ensures performing a merge …
Fast forward merge vs merge commit
Did you know?
WebFeb 20, 2024 · Try Merge commit, Squash merge, or fast-forward merge. Next time you want to merge a pull request, try out the merge commit, squash merge, or fast-forward merge. If you’re new to Bitbucket, sign up for an account, import some code, add your team mates and have them review your code via a pull request. When you are ready to … WebJan 1, 2024 · So, when it’s time to merge, git recurses over the branch and creates a new merge commit. The merge commit continues to have two parents. Command: $ git …
WebMar 14, 2024 · Multiple merge bases. The Files tab in a pull request detects diffs by a three-side comparison. The algorithm takes into account the last commit in the target branch, the last commit in the source branch, and their common merge base (i.e. the best common ancestor). The algorithm is a fast, cost-efficient, and reliable method of detecting changes. WebMay 10, 2024 · Resolve is suitable for criss-cross merge situations as well as “regular” merges where the merge history might be complex. Fast-forward merge. Main advantage: Fast and clean if there’s a linear path to the target branch. As mentioned, the fast-forward merge strategy is a type of implicit merge. It’s used quite commonly, thanks to its ...
WebOct 23, 2024 · You can resolve merge conflicts during a rebase in the same way that you resolve merge conflicts during a merge. Rebase vs. no-fast-forward merge. Git rebasing results in a simpler but less exact commit history than a no-fast-forward merge, otherwise known as a three-way or true merge. When you want a record of a merge in the commit … WebIn that way, the rebase and merge behavior resembles a fast-forward merge by maintaining a linear project history. However, rebasing achieves this by re-writing the commit history on the base branch with new …
WebAug 2, 2024 · Fast Forward Merge. If we change our example so no new commits were made to the base branch since our branch was created, Git can do something called a “Fast Forward Merge”. This is the same as a …
WebApr 12, 2024 · Git Rebase Vs Git Merge Git Coding How To Apply The general syntax for this git command is: git merge no ff the git merge no ff command merges the … clomiphene citrate research chemicalWebThe merge strategies available in Bitbucket are: Merge commit ( --no-ff) DEFAULT : Always create a new merge commit and update the target branch to it, even if the source branch is already up to date with the target branch. Fast-forward ( --ff ): If the source branch is out of date with the target branch, create a merge commit. body and brain scarsdaleWebJun 7, 2024 · More specifically, squashing during a merge generates the working tree and index state to match a merge without actually creating a merge commit. You can then use git commit to handle the rest on your … clomiphene citrate pharmacological actionWebApr 12, 2024 · 合并分支 ps : 默认当前在master分支 1.常规命令 git merge dev // 不会产生commit节点 // 或者 git merge dev --no--ff // 会产生一个commit节点 // --ff 是 fast forward 例如,开发一直在master分支进行,但忽然有一个新的想法,于是新建了一个develop的分支,并在其上进行一系列提交 ... body and brain yoga arlington maWebThe merge commit content is also explicit in the fact that it shows which commits were the parents of the merge commit. Some teams avoid explicit merges because arguably the … body and brain trainer findenWebSep 20, 2024 · A Git fast forward is an extremely useful and efficient mechanism for harmonizing your project's main branch with changes introduced in a given feature … body and brain yoga aspen hillWebIn the latter case, the resulting merge commit serves as a symbolic joining of the two branches. Our first example demonstrates a fast-forward merge. The code below … clomiphene cost without insurance